Do event managers have ability to create multiple ticket types and custom fields on the front end and also not allow other event admins to see them?
December 12, 2017 at 12:01 am #1403391JenniferKeymasterHello,
Thanks for checking out Community Tickets!
Event organizers can create multiple tickets on their events, but the custom fields functionality that comes with Event Tickets Plus is not currently available on the front end form. Sorry for the bad news there! While organizers can edit their own events, they cannot edit other organizers’ events/tickets. However, there is not anything built-in that would prevent them from seeing other organizers’ events/tickets on the front end.
